Wall Street Journal: Informed Sources Say Nikki Haley Withdraws from Election

The Wall Street Journal reports that informed sources say Nikki Haley will withdraw from the election.

According to informed sources, Nikki Haley, the former U.S. ambassador to the United Nations, intends to suspend her presidential campaign today, Wednesday.

Sources familiar with Nikki Haley’s plans told the Wall Street Journal that she, who was formerly the governor of South Carolina, intends to announce her withdrawal from the U.S. presidential campaign.

Haley, who was the U.S. representative to the UN in the former Trump administration, suffered a heavy defeat in the primaries in 15 states on Tuesday, securing votes from only one state.

Trump won 14 out of 15 Republican primary elections on Tuesday.
